In this review of the Anime Cosplay Swords Building Set the bottom line is simple: this 806-piece White Zoro Ichimonji replica is for fans who want a large, display-ready cosplay prop that doubles as a rewarding build. The set aims to reproduce the Wado Ichimonji look using high-quality luminous building blocks and includes a scabbard and bracket for display. While assembly can be satisfying and the finished 39in sword makes a convincing samurai-style prop, buyers should be prepared for a detailed build and to check the kit for missing or ill-fitting pieces.
Key Features
- Accurate design: The set is carefully designed to resemble the Wado Ichimonji sword and captures the sword silhouette and proportions for authentic display.
- 806-piece build: A mid-complexity construction that delivers a substantial 39in finished sword, offering a tangible sense of accomplishment when completed.
- Luminous blocks: High-quality luminous pieces give the sword a glow effect that enhances shelf presence in dim light and emphasizes details in the blade.
- Included scabbard and bracket: The pack includes a scabbard and a bracket so the finished sword can be stored or displayed without extra purchases.
- Compatibility: Bricks are stated to be compatible with major brands, allowing for replacement or customization with common building elements.
- Clear instructions: The package provides step-by-step instructions and stickers to guide assembly and finish the visual look.
Who It's For
The set is best suited to anime and One Piece collectors who want a large, displayable replica that also serves as an engaging build project; it is appropriate for adults and older kids aged 8 and up who enjoy hands-on construction and cosplay props. Builders who value a luminous visual effect and a full scabbard for shelf mounting will appreciate the finished presentation.
Those who should look elsewhere include buyers seeking a lightweight, ready-to-wear cosplay sword or a product guaranteed to arrive perfectly complete without any part checks; customers who dislike fiddly pieces or expect a quick assembly may find this set more demanding than anticipated.

Is the finished sword suitable for cosplay?
The 39in length and assembled structure make it a convincing prop for cosplay and display, but it is intended for light swinging only and not vigorous use.
Are replacement parts available if pieces are missing?
The seller asks customers to contact them with missing parts details so they can try to resolve the issue and supply replacements.
How difficult is assembly?
Difficulty is mixed: some builders find the clear instructions easy to follow, while others report fiddly steps and occasional fit issues, so expect a moderate build challenge.
